Comprehending Counterfeit GoodsMeaning and Types
Counterfeit products are items that are made to mimic genuine products without the consent of the hallmark or patent holder. These products can consist of:

The Mechanics of Ordering Fakes OnlineWhere to Find Counterfeits
Counterfeit products are often offered through numerous online platforms, consisting of:
E-commerce platforms: Websites like Alibaba, eBay, and Etsy can include both genuine and counterfeit items.Social network: Instagram and Facebook shops typically promote counterfeit items due to lack of regulation.Uncontrolled sites: Many less-known online stores concentrate on offering branded items at a portion of their price.The Role of Social Media
Social media platforms have actually accelerated the reach of counterfeiters, enabling them to showcase products through flashy advertisements and influencer recommendations. The viral nature of these platforms suggests counterfeit items can spread quickly, reaching millions in simply a short time.

The Risks of Purchasing CounterfeitsLegal Consequences
Purchasing counterfeit products can cause legal repercussions, both for the buyer and seller. Countries have stringent laws versus the sale of counterfeit goods, and purchasers might face fines depending upon the jurisdiction.
Security Concerns
Counterfeit items, particularly cosmetics and electronic devices, might position serious health and wellness risks. For circumstances, fake electronic devices may not meet safety requirements, causing prospective hazards such as getting too hot or fires. Cosmetics might include hazardous chemicals that can cause skin reactions or long-term health effects.

Q2: Are there legal implications for purchasing counterfeit goods?
A2: Yes, purchasing fakes can cause legal action depending upon local laws, as it supports unlawful trade.
Q3: Can counterfeit products be returned?
A3: Most counterfeit items are sold without a return policy, and returning them can be tough.
Q4: How can I report counterfeit goods?
A4: You can report counterfeit items to local authorities or organizations that manage intellectual property rights, such as the International Anti-Counterfeiting Coalition (IACC).
